Block
#12,810,090
26w
11 txs778,232 confs
Transactions
11
Total Output
₳451,330.99
$67.87K
Fees
₳3.06
Size
20.19 KB
20,674 bytes
Details
Hash
3396f78b9c8cb9f94f67c9c6bc14ca612973303be91af29bda504e57cbf2c63c
Epoch / Slot
Epoch 602 · slot 174,849,888 · epoch-slot 149,088
Timestamp
26w · Mon, 22 Dec 2025 15:09:39 GMT
Block producer
VRF key
vrf_vk13…7qm5k80v
Op cert
c8e9abc3…116788c6
Op cert counter
27